EXB-28N562JX Description
The EXB-28N562JX from Panasonic Electronic Components is a high-performance, surface-mount resistor network designed for precision applications in compact electronic assemblies. This 4-resistor array features isolated circuit configuration with a resistance value of 5.6kΩ per element, offering a tolerance of ±5% and a temperature coefficient of ±200ppm/°C for stable performance across varying environmental conditions. Encased in an ultra-low-profile 0804 convex package with long-side terminals, it measures just 2.00mm x 1.00mm (0.079" x 0.039") with a seated height of 0.45mm (0.018"), making it ideal for space-constrained designs. The device delivers 63mW power per element and is supplied in tape-and-reel (TR) packaging for automated assembly efficiency.
EXB-28N562JX Features
- Compact 0804 Package: Optimized for high-density PCB layouts with minimal footprint.
- High Reliability: ±200ppm/°C temperature coefficient ensures consistent performance under thermal stress.
- Isolated Circuit Design: Each resistor operates independently, reducing crosstalk in sensitive circuits.
- Automation-Ready: Tape-and-reel packaging supports high-speed pick-and-place assembly.
- RoHS/REACH Compliance: Environmentally friendly and suitable for global markets (ECCN: EAR99, HTSUS: 8533.21.0020).
- Low-Profile Construction: 0.45mm height enables use in thin devices like wearables and mobile electronics.
EXB-28N562JX Applications
This resistor array excels in applications demanding precision and space efficiency, including:
- Consumer Electronics: Voltage division and signal conditioning in smartphones, tablets, and IoT devices.
- Industrial Controls: Current-limiting and pull-up/pull-down networks in PLCs and sensor interfaces.
- Automotive Systems: Robust performance for infotainment and ADAS modules (non-safety-critical).
- Medical Devices: Reliable operation in portable diagnostic equipment due to low thermal drift.
- Communications: Impedance matching in RF and high-speed digital circuits.
